    can you turn it on with a two button restart?

    Step 1: press and hold the power button on your Surface for 30 seconds.

    Step 2: press and hold volume-up button and the power button on your Surface at

    the same time for at least 15 seconds, and then release both.

    The screen may flash the Surface logo, but continue holding the buttons

    down for at least 15 seconds.

    Step 3: After you release the buttons, wait 10 seconds.

    Step 4: Press and release the power button again to turn your Surface back on.

    if you cant turn it on, return and repurchase.
